3. Dania Beach Fishing Pier
SCENIC WATERFRONT LANDMARK
The Dania Beach Fishing Pier stretches out into the Atlantic and provides sweeping ocean views, daily fishing, and people-watching opportunities. Open from early morning to midnight, the pier is a favorite for both casual anglers and serious fishermen targeting species like tarpon and snook, with a bait and tackle shop on site. Its unique vantage point and lively atmosphere make it a beloved community gathering spot and a highlight of Dania Beach's waterfront.

10. Oleta River State Park
RIVERSIDE URBAN WILDERNESS
Oleta River State Park is Florida's largest urban park, renowned for its winding river, mountain biking trails, and sandy swimming beach on Biscayne Bay. Kayaking, paddleboarding, and fishing are the highlights, with lush mangroves forming a natural playground for adventurers. Its blend of urban access and wilderness atmosphere creates a notable waterfront escape near Dania Beach.
